  3. Verdana -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Verdana

    Verdana is a font designed by Matthew Carter for Microsoft in 1996, with variations such as Verdana Pro and Verdana Ref. It is widely used on Windows, Mac OS and web platforms, and has distinctive features such as large x-height, wide counters and looser letter-spacing.

  5. Impact (typeface)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Impact_(typeface)

    Impact is a sans-serif typeface in the industrial or grotesque style designed by Geoffrey Lee in 1965. It is known for its use in web design, Windows, and memes, and has a high x-height, compressed letterspacing, and minimal interior counterform.

  6. Helvetica -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Helvetica

    Helvetica, also known as Neue Haas Grotesk, is a widely used sans-serif typeface developed in 1957 by Swiss designers. It is a neo-grotesque design influenced by Akzidenz-Grotesk and other German and Swiss styles, and has a dense, solid appearance with tight spacing and square-looking letters.

  8. Futura (typeface)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Futura_(typeface)

    Futura is a sans-serif typeface created by Paul Renner in 1927 as a contribution to the New Frankfurt project. It is based on simple geometric shapes and has a modern and efficient appearance, but also shows some classic influences.
